Skip to content

Commit c3c19f2

Browse files
committed
cleanup deprecates methods
1 parent ce72a8a commit c3c19f2

File tree

7 files changed

+27
-337
lines changed

7 files changed

+27
-337
lines changed

changelog

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,6 @@
1+
[SNAPSHOT]
2+
* cleanup deprecates methods
3+
14
[6.5.0]
25
* separate OAuth1.0a and OAuth2.0 ServiceBuilders,
36
introduce AuthorizationUrlBuilder (along with deprecation of AuthorizationUrlWithPKCE)

scribejava-core/src/main/java/com/github/scribejava/core/builder/ServiceBuilder.java

Lines changed: 3 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-51,26 +51,20 @@ public ServiceBuilder apiSecret(String apiSecret) {
5151
return this;
5252
}
5353

54-
/**
55-
* @deprecated use {@link ServiceBuilderOAuth20#defaultScope(java.lang.String)} or
56-
* {@link ServiceBuilderOAuth10a#withScope(java.lang.String)}
57-
*/
58-
@Override
59-
@Deprecated
60-
public ServiceBuilder scope(String scope) {
54+
private ServiceBuilder setScope(String scope) {
6155
Preconditions.checkEmptyString(scope, "Invalid OAuth scope");
6256
this.scope = scope;
6357
return this;
6458
}
6559

6660
@Override
6761
public ServiceBuilderOAuth20 defaultScope(String defaultScope) {
68-
return scope(defaultScope);
62+
return setScope(defaultScope);
6963
}
7064

7165
@Override
7266
public ServiceBuilderOAuth10a withScope(String scope) {
73-
return scope(scope);
67+
return setScope(scope);
7468
}
7569

7670
@Override

scribejava-core/src/main/java/com/github/scribejava/core/builder/ServiceBuilderCommon.java

Lines changed: 0 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-34,17 +34,6 @@ public interface ServiceBuilderCommon {
3434
*/
3535
ServiceBuilderCommon apiSecret(String apiSecret);
3636

37-
/**
38-
* Configures the OAuth scope. This is only necessary in some APIs (like Google's).
39-
*
40-
* @param scope The OAuth scope
41-
* @return the {@link ServiceBuilder} instance for method chaining
42-
* @deprecated use {@link ServiceBuilderOAuth20#defaultScope(java.lang.String)} or
43-
* {@link ServiceBuilderOAuth10a#withScope(java.lang.String)}
44-
*/
45-
@Deprecated
46-
ServiceBuilderCommon scope(String scope);
47-
4837
ServiceBuilderCommon httpClientConfig(HttpClientConfig httpClientConfig);
4938

5039
/**

scribejava-core/src/main/java/com/github/scribejava/core/builder/ServiceBuilderOAuth10a.java

Lines changed: 0 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-17,13 +17,6 @@ public interface ServiceBuilderOAuth10a extends ServiceBuilderCommon {
1717
@Override
1818
ServiceBuilderOAuth20 apiSecret(String apiSecret);
1919

20-
/**
21-
* @deprecated use {@link #withScope(java.lang.String) }
22-
*/
23-
@Override
24-
@Deprecated
25-
ServiceBuilderOAuth20 scope(String scope);
26-
2720
@Override
2821
ServiceBuilderOAuth20 httpClientConfig(HttpClientConfig httpClientConfig);
2922

scribejava-core/src/main/java/com/github/scribejava/core/builder/ServiceBuilderOAuth20.java

Lines changed: 0 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-16,13 +16,6 @@ public interface ServiceBuilderOAuth20 extends ServiceBuilderCommon {
1616
@Override
1717
ServiceBuilderOAuth20 apiSecret(String apiSecret);
1818

19-
/**
20-
* @deprecated use {@link #defaultScope(java.lang.String) }
21-
*/
22-
@Override
23-
@Deprecated
24-
ServiceBuilderOAuth20 scope(String scope);
25-
2619
@Override
2720
ServiceBuilderOAuth20 httpClientConfig(HttpClientConfig httpClientConfig);
2821

0 commit comments

Comments
 (0)